BUTTONS FOR ALTERNATE FEATURES 
 
IDENT 
Pressing the IDENT button will activate the SPIP (Special Position Identification Pulse) signal for 
approximately 20 seconds. This signal will "paint" an instantly identifiable image on the controller’s scope. 
This signal must only be used upon request of a "Squawk IDENT" from the controller. Use at any other time 
could interfere with another aircraft sending a SPIP. The IDENT legend will appear in the Code window while 
the Ident signal is being sent. 
 
VFR 
Pressing the VFR button will cause the squawk code to either change from the user entered code to a VFR code 
or change back to the user entered code from the currently displayed VFR code. The last used squawk code is 
automatically recalled when the unit is cycled off and on. 
 
HOLD 
Pressing the HOLD button will enter the Altitude Hold mode and lock the current altitude as the HOLD 
altitude. The Altitude display area will now show the altitude difference relative to the HOLD altitude in 100ft 
increments. The altitude display area will flash if the Altitude Buffer value is exceeded. Additionally if the audio 
alert function has been installed, a warning will be heard. The audio warning will be present only while the unit 
is in the Altitude Hold mode.  This is a warning only and is not tied to any navigation systems. 
 
Depressing the HOLD button for two seconds or longer will allow the setting of the Altitude Buffer. The 
available range is 200ft to 2500ft. Once set, momentarily pressing HOLD again will save this buffer value. The 
buffer value will be retained when the unit is powered off. This mode must be exited before other functions can 
be accessed. Once started this mode will be exited when it has been inactive for 10 seconds. 
 
FUNC 
Pressing the FUNC button cycles the timer display between Flight TimerCount Up Timer, and Count Down 
Timer
.  
 
Holding the FUNC button in for 5 seconds or longer will Flip/Flop the left and right display areas. This 
function is extremely useful in the unlikely event of an unreadable LCD display. When the unit is turned off it 
will always restart with the displays in their default locations.  
 
START/STOP 
Pressing the START/STOP button will independently start or stop the Count Up and Count Down timers 
depending on which is currently displayed. 
 
CRSR/CLR 
When in Flight Timer, depressing the CRSR/CLR button for two seconds will reset the Flight Timer
When in Count Up Timer, depressing the CRSR/CLR button for two seconds will reset the Count Up Timer
 
When in Count Down Timer, with the timer stopped, momentarily pressing the CRSR/CLR button once will 
recall the preset count down time. Momentarily pressing this button again will activate the cursor in the timer 
window. At this point, changes to the Count Down Timer value can be made by using the Code Selector/Data 
Entry knob.
